About The Position

You will be responsible for leading the maintenance and repair activities of plant equipment. This work requires the ability to make decisions based on established tools, applications, and procedures; and is of a technical nature using independent judgment within the limits of GMS, focusing on Safety, People, Quality, Responsiveness, Cost, and Environment (SPQRCE). Support rotational shifts per operation plans As the Mechanical Lead, you will be responsible for a small to medium group of maintenance employees including Electricians, Millwrights, Pipefitters and Toolmakers. You will lead all the mechanical maintenance, repair of plant equipment, create preventative maintenance plans; conduct appropriate checks and tests, and communicate evaluation of results and generate reports to improve uptime of equipment.
